What is Stackdriver?

Stackdriver is Google Cloud’s embedded observability suite designed to monitor, troubleshoot, and improve cloud infrastructure, software, and application performance. Stackdriver enables you to efficiently build and run workloads, keeping applications performant and available.Click to see full answer. Also, what is Stackdriver monitoring?Stackdriver Monitoring measures the health of cloud resources and applications by providing visibility into metrics such as CPU usage, disk I/O, memory, network traffic and uptime. It is based on collectd, an open source daemon that collects system and application performance metrics.Secondly, what is the purpose of the Stackdriver trace service? Stackdriver Trace is a distributed tracing system that collects latency data from your applications and displays it in the Google Cloud Platform Console. You can track how requests propagate through your application and receive detailed near real-time performance insights. In this way, what is Stackdriver logging? Stackdriver Logging is a fully managed service that performs at scale and can ingest application and system log data, as well as custom log data from thousands of VMs. Stackdriver Logging allows you to analyze and export selected logs to long-term storage in real time.
